Will Israel’s regulator approve Phoenix’s Abu Dhabi deal?

The announcement final week that Abu Dhabi Growth Holding Co. (ADQ) is ready to purchase management of Israel’s largest insurance coverage firm Israel Phoenix Assurance Ltd. (TASE:PHOE1; PHOE5) continues to make waves on the Tel Aviv Inventory Alternate (TASE).

For the time being it’s onerous to inform whether or not the native regulator will permit US funds Centerbridge and Gallatin Level Capital to promote a 25% stake to ADQ. If the deal goes forward will probably be for NIS 2.3 billion, reflecting an organization valuation of NIS 9.2 billion for the Phoenix.

There are additionally these within the capital market and amongst Israel’s public who oppose the deal and argue that on the very least the restrictions ought to be tightened on any new homeowners of an insurance coverage firm that manages greater than NIS 370 billion in property, the overwhelming majority of that are public financial savings in Israel.

A senior capital market supervisor mentioned, “If I had been the Supervisor of Capital Markets, Insurance coverage and Financial savings, which is the primary regulator that should approve the deal, I might both not approve it in any respect or I might approve it topic to very strict circumstances, a lot stricter than these established by the Supervisor.

He mentions the round about “administrators of a public organizations,” which at present says, amongst different issues, that the chairman of the board doesn’t need to be Israeli, and even dwell in Israel completely. However the senior capital market supervisor says that to guard the pursuits of savers, the circumstances have to be tightened and provides that the chairman of the board and the vast majority of members of the board of administrators ought to be Israeli. He additionally insists that one should guarantee compliance with one other situation that’s outlined in the identical round, by which all members of the funding committee in an organization will need to have Israeli citizenship, reside in Israel and be proficient in Hebrew.

He says that the Supervisor might be assisted in decreasing international involvement by different regulators, such because the Financial institution of Israel, with regard to considerations about cash laundering, and the Israel Securities Authority (ISA), for the reason that Phoenix owns an organization for managing funding portfolios and mutual funds.

He says, “The primary concern is in regards to the means to forestall the intervention of a international group in managing investments, in a manner that may tilt the investments in a route that may match the overall coverage of that governing physique. It’s doable to border and outline exercise to forestall such a bias, however since (ADQ) is a authorities fund, it complicates issues. On something that they search to intervene, and as somebody who is aware of the capital market carefully, I do know that international our bodies are inclined to intervene, it is going to instantly tackle a political colour and sign hazard of a diplomatic disaster.”




Concerning restrictions imposed on any buying firm, he compares them to attempting to lure water in a pool, which can all the time search for the weak level to movement out. “Regardless of how a lot they attempt to assume upfront the way to stop interference, those that need to intervene and management the levers of strain – can get what they need. It is onerous to shut all of the loopholes. However, if an organization buys one other firm, you’ll be able to’t inform them that is forbidden or that’s forbidden, as a result of then they ask themselves what are they getting from the funding they’ve made? It’s unattainable to neutralize them from affect fully as a result of they’re the controlling social gathering, so there may be additionally a restrict to the restrictions.”

In a small market like Israel the dangers are particularly massive

In fact, makes an attempt by controlling homeowners to affect monetary companies underneath their management usually are not related solely to international controlling homeowners. It is sufficient to recall management of IDB and thus Clal Insurance coverage by Nochi Dankner greater than a decade in the past, to grasp that the danger of the intervention by a home controlling shareholder in such a small market as Israel, could also be even better.

Nonetheless, not like Israeli inner interference within the energy relations between controlling homeowners and funding committees, which ought to be fully separated from the board and administration, when a fund managed by a international authorities is concerned, any disagreements might have a geopolitical tone.

“The underside line is that it’s harmful to approve the deal, not solely by way of makes an attempt to intervene in investments, with all of the restrictions that shall be imposed, however due to the explosive potential that would result in a deterioration in relations between Israel and Abu Dhabi. However it’s clear that incoming Prime Minister Benjamin Netanyahu has an curiosity on this matter to indicate that the Abraham Accords are bearing fruit. “Clearly there shall be strain from the client in addition to from the sellers. The US funds will ask if Israel is a free market solely when you should buy, however while you need to promote – then it’s now not a free market,” says the senior capital market supervisor. “I do not know who will grow to be the Supervisor of Capital Market, Insurance coverage and Financial savings (at present Amit Gal holds the place as deputy), however they should be very robust to resist all these pressures.”

“Change does not occur in at some point however seeps in”

Instantly after publication of the signing of the memorandum of understanding to purchase management of the Phoenix, a political determine instructed “Globes” that the choice to approve the deal ought to be made on the political degree moderately than by regulators as a result of Israeli authorities’s curiosity in fulfilling the UAE dedication to speculate $10 billion in Israel.

The senior political determine mentioned, “If it was a personal firm from Abu Dhabi, it may have been put via the skilled channels and certain there can be no motive to disqualify it, simply as they didn’t disqualify the American funds that management the Israeli insurance coverage group right now. However on condition that it’s a government-owned fund, it’s simpler to be unhealthy and say no upfront. Will this be useful? I am undecided.

“However will the Emirati actually be capable to change Phoenix’s DNA? Re-channel investments or block reforms? There are excellent folks on the Phoenix right now. However what’s going to occur if tomorrow they alter. The time period of the members of the funding committee will finish and there could possibly be strain to nominate new administrators and exterior board member. The whole lot can change. When a enterprise is bought and a brand new controlling proprietor arrives with a distinct organizational tradition, the change doesn’t occur in at some point, however slowly it seeps via. It’s not obligatory for the consumers to make dramatic modifications, it’s sufficient that it conveys invisible messages so that folks within the group perceive what the commander needs, and align themselves with the place the wind is blowing.”

“The Abu Dhabi fund doesn’t want the financial savings”

However, a former monetary providers firm govt who is aware of nicely what’s going on between the insurance coverage corporations and the regulator, is much less apprehensive in regards to the identification of the potential purchaser, in contrast with earlier events in Phoenix, reminiscent of Chinese language funding funds. “The priority with the Chinese language was that they’d attempt to divert savers’ funds to makes use of which are handy for them, however not good for Israeli savers. This isn’t the case right here. The Abu Dhabi fund doesn’t want funds, they’ve extra funds, so the state of affairs is the other – they are going to need to make investments.

“That is why I am not involved that they are going to divert funds to unhealthy makes use of or that they are going to withdraw funds. The one factor which may occur is that they’d need to take part as a co-investor in Phoenix’s investments, and I do not see something unhealthy in that. It can enhance the involvement of the State of Israel by events we need to keep in touch with. These funds convey information and connections and the Phoenix can construct on that, so there are additionally advantages to the deal and never simply considerations.”

Based on this govt, the query just isn’t whether or not or to not give a allow, however underneath what circumstances. “In any case, the insurance coverage regulator has the best to intervene in what’s going on on the insurer from now till additional discover, and if they’re vigilant sufficient they are going to be capable to ensure that nothing inappropriate occurs. I additionally heard considerations about the usage of the purchasers’ info. Those that have management over an insurance coverage firm or some other institutional physique don’t have particular person info, however solely in an aggregated method that doesn’t permit identification.”
